About Omars

Omars is a popular Indian restaurant located on Great Horton Road in Bradford, renowned for its authentic flavours and vibrant dining experience. With a strong Google rating of 4.4 out of 5 stars from over 600 reviews, it's a favourite among locals and visitors seeking quality South Asian cuisine.

Diners can expect a diverse menu featuring classic Indian dishes, with many praising the well-spiced and perfectly cooked curries, such as the much-loved butter chicken. The restaurant strives to offer a welcoming atmosphere, aiming to provide a great night out with exceptional food and helpful guidance on menu choices from the team.

Visiting Information

Omars welcomes guests daily, opening at 5:00 PM. From Monday to Thursday and on Sunday, the restaurant closes at 12:00 AM, while on Fridays and Saturdays, it extends its hours until 2:00 AM. The premises are wheelchair accessible, including both the entrance and seating areas, ensuring a comfortable experience for all. For convenience, Omars accepts various payment methods, including credit cards, debit cards, and NFC payments.
